The Fundamentals of Slot Volatility and Its Impact

Slot volatility, often referred to as variance, dictates the risk and reward balance within a slot machine’s gameplay. High volatility slots tend to offer less frequent but larger payouts, whereas low volatility slots yield smaller but more regular wins. Understanding this concept is crucial for interpreting player patterns because volatility directly influences how players experience swings in their bankroll over time. Recognizing these swings through real player outcomes highlights the importance of volatility in shaping the overall gaming session.

Real player data shows that the emotional response to volatility varies significantly. Some gravitate toward high volatility slots due to the allure of substantial jackpots, while others prefer the steadier returns of low volatility games. The patterns that develop from these preferences can hint at how different volatility levels cater to varying play styles and risk appetites.

Decoding Real Player Patterns in Slot Gameplay

Analyzing real player patterns involves looking at how sequences of wins and losses unfold during gameplay sessions. Unlike theoretical models, these patterns reflect actual human interaction, including bet sizing, timing, and response to previous outcomes. Observations from extensive player data reveal that while slot outcomes are determined by random number generators, the way players adjust their strategies in response to wins or losses introduces distinct behavior profiles.

For instance, players facing extended dry spells might reduce bets, seek lower volatility options, or switch games altogether. Conversely, players on winning streaks may increase their wagers, chasing larger prizes. Understanding these behavioral patterns is key to navigating slot volatility, as they can influence how volatility manifests in session outcomes from the player’s perspective.

Practical Considerations When Navigating Slot Volatility

When engaging with slots, it’s important to approach volatility with realistic expectations and awareness of associated risks. Volatility can lead to extended periods without wins, which may impact bankroll management and player experience. Recognizing patterns from real player behavior can assist in preparing for these fluctuations but does not guarantee outcomes.

Developing strategies that incorporate volatility understanding includes setting loss limits, pacing play sessions, and selecting games aligned with one’s risk tolerance. While certain patterns may emerge from aggregated player data, each session remains unique due to the inherent randomness of slot machines.

Additionally, it’s prudent to maintain a balanced perspective on gambling activities, acknowledging their entertainment nature and the potential for financial loss. Responsible gaming practices are essential to ensure that interactions with slots remain enjoyable and sustainable over time.
